Dr Space Junk vs The Universe

Alice Gorman, a space archaeologist, explores the artifacts left behind in space and on Earth, from moon dust to Elon Musk's red sports car. These objects can be massive or tiny, bold or hopeful, and raise questions about human encounters with space. Gorman, affectionately known as "Dr Space Junk," takes readers on a journey through the solar system and beyond, deploying space artifacts, historical explorations, and even the occasional cocktail recipe in search of the ways we make space meaningful.
